Informational Social Influence
The process of changing one’s behavior to align with the group's, based on the belief that the group possesses accurate information.
Social Facilitation
The tendency for people to perform differently when in the presence of others than when alone, often improving on simple tasks.
Deindividuation
A psychological state characterized by diminished self-consciousness, reduced concern for social evaluation, and weakened restraints against prohibited behaviors in groups.
Normative Social Influence
The influence of other people that leads us to conform in order to be liked and accepted by them, affecting our views, attitudes, and behaviors.
